Where to stay in Upper Town

Find the best Upper Town are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Bath City Centre

1 out of top 10 points of interest in this area

The lively bars and relaxing spas are top of the list for many visitors to Bath City Centre. A stop by Thermae Bath Spa or Roman Baths might round out your trip.

Bathwick

If you're spending some time in Bathwick, The Holburne Museum and The Recreation Ground are top sights worth seeing.

Bear Flat

While there might not be top attractions in Bear Flat, you can explore the larger area and discover places like Thermae Bath Spa and Sally Lunn's.

Oldfield Park

Though Oldfield Park may not have many top sights, you can venture to the surrounding area to see attractions like Theatre Royal Bath and No. 1 Royal Crescent.

Walcot

If you're spending some time in Walcot, Artisan Quarter and Milsom Quarter are top sights worth seeing.

Can I cancel my hotel reservation on Expedia?
Many Expedia hotel reservations are refundable, provided that you cancel before the hotel's cancellation deadline – this is often within 24-48 hours of your scheduled arrival. If you have a non-refundable booking, it might still be possible to receive a refund if you cancel it within 24 hours of booking. Be sure to check your booking confirmation for the exact cancellation policy.
